The Vancouver Board of Education oversees a vast portfolio of educational facilities across British Columbia focused on creating safe and efficient learning environments. Their commitment to sustainable development is evident in the integration of high performance building standards for new school construction and major renovations. By prioritizing seismic resilience and energy efficiency, the organization ensures that public infrastructure meets modern environmental requirements and safety protocols. Many of their recent initiatives involve transitioning legacy heating systems to advanced heat pump technology to reduce carbon emissions. The board actively manages large scale capital projects that incorporate natural lighting and improved indoor air quality for the benefit of students and staff. Through collaboration with various experts, they implement innovative solutions such as rooftop solar installations and water conservation systems. This forward thinking approach to institutional facility management sets a benchmark for public sector sustainability within the region. Their ongoing efforts contribute significantly to the local community by fostering healthier spaces and reducing the ecological footprint of the school district.
